资源简介:
核心采用“编码生成-数据关联-智能分析”三阶联动算法架构,细节如下:①编码生成算法:运用随机数加密算法生成唯一二维码标识编码,确保一物一码的唯一性,编码重复率为0;②数据关联算法:基于图数据库的关联算法,将二维码编码与产品溯源、物流、营销等多维度数据建立关联,关联准确率≥99.9%;③智能分析算法:采用协同过滤算法分析消费者扫码行为与消费偏好,构建用户画像标签体系,同时运用回归分析模型分析扫码数据与营销转化的关联关系。算法经1亿+条二维码数据训练,经第三方机构验证:扫码数据解析响应时间≤0.5秒,用户画像匹配准确率≥95%,每月基于新增扫码数据迭代优化模型。
The core adopts a three-stage linked algorithm architecture of "code generation-data association-intelligent analysis", with detailed specifications as follows:
① Code Generation Algorithm: A random number encryption algorithm is employed to generate unique QR code identification codes, ensuring the uniqueness of the "one item, one code" principle, with a 0 duplicate code rate;
② Data Association Algorithm: A graph database-based association algorithm is utilized to establish associations between QR code identification codes and multi-dimensional data including product traceability, logistics, marketing and other dimensions, with an association accuracy of ≥99.9%;
③ Intelligent Analysis Algorithm: A collaborative filtering algorithm is adopted to analyze consumer scanning behaviors and consumption preferences, and build a user portrait tag system. Meanwhile, a regression analysis model is applied to analyze the correlation between scanning data and marketing conversion. The algorithm is trained on over 100 million QR code data entries. Verified by a third-party organization: the scanning data analysis response time is ≤0.5 seconds, the user portrait matching accuracy is ≥95%, and the model is iteratively optimized monthly based on newly added scanning data.

数据集介绍

背景与挑战
背景概述
该数据集是贵州酱酒集团有限公司自行产生的10G规模数据,每周更新,专注于酱酒瓶身二维码的关联信息。其核心特点在于通过唯一二维码实现产品溯源防伪和消费者行为分析,应用算法包括编码生成、数据关联和智能分析,支持防伪、营销优化和生产管理等多场景应用。
